HeavyTechRuby / history

History of every building
GNU General Public License v3.0
8 stars 8 forks source link

Интегрировать docker для локальной разработки #80

Closed o-200 closed 2 months ago

o-200 commented 3 months ago

На данный момент приходится локально запускать проект используя rails server, также нужно иметь у себя локально заранее заготовленную субд или готовый docker compose.

Было бы удобно запускать проект, прогонять тесты и выполнять другие итерации с помощью конкретных команд, которые автоматически запускают контейнер и выполняют внутри него заготовленные действия (запуск сервера, прогон тестов и тп).

материал: https://evilmartians.com/chronicles/ruby-on-whales-docker-for-ruby-rails-development

что можно использовать: https://github.com/bibendi/dip https://github.com/sergio-fry/devup